The MUR420 A0G belongs to the category of ultrafast rectifier diodes.
These diodes are commonly used in power supply circuits, inverters, and other electronic devices where fast and efficient rectification is required.
The MUR420 A0G is typically available in a DO-201AD package.
The essence of the MUR420 A0G lies in its ability to swiftly and efficiently convert alternating current (AC) to direct current (DC) in electronic circuits.
These diodes are us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The MUR420 A0G typically has two pins, with the anode connected to the positive terminal and the cathode connected to the negative terminal in the circuit.
The MUR420 A0G operates on the principle of utilizing its ultrafast recovery time to swiftly switch from conducting to non-conducting states during the rectification process, thereby converting AC to DC with minimal loss.
The MUR420 A0G is widely used in power supply circuits for various electronic devices, ensuring efficient conversion of AC to DC for stable operation.
